SUMMARY:Winnipeg Transit Master Plan - Public Engagement - Open House
DESCRIPTION:The City wants to hear from Winnipeggers about the future of our transit system to help shape the Winnipeg Transit Master Plan. The Winnipeg Transit Master Plan is a 25-year plan that will cover all aspects of the transit system – Transit\, Rapid Transit\, and Transit Plus (formerly Handi-Transit) service and infrastructure. \n“We expect Winnipeg to be home to nearly one million people within the next 25 years and our transit system needs to grow along with the city\,” said Kevin Sturgeon\, Senior Transit Planner. “This project will give us an opportunity to talk to Winnipeggers about what’s important to them in a transit system for the future.” \nIn the first phase of public engagement\, the project team will talk to Winnipeggers about how they currently use transit services\, what is important to them\, and what they would like to see in the future. The information gathered will be presented in a report that identifies key areas of study for the Transit Master Plan project. \nFrom March 15 to April 20\, Winnipeggers are invited to provide input online\, by email at: transitmasterplan@winnipeg.ca\, or in person at one of five open houses\, or at one of six pop-up events throughout the city.
